### Escalation: currency conversion rounding errors

If reconciliation flags discrepancies greater than 0.01 in any settlement batch, treat it as a release blocker. First, confirm whether the Meridial rates service returned mid-market or bid rates for the affected window — rounding drift usually traces back to a rate-source mismatch, not the converter itself. Capture the batch ID range and the rate snapshot before paging anyone. If the discrepancy persists after a rate replay, escalate to the payments correctness team at the address below.

billing contact of yawip-yadup = druath.casdor@nelvrolabs.internal

Subject: Gateway rate limiting going live Thursday

Hey team — quick note for the release channel. We're enabling per-client rate limits on the Ostrello internal gateway this Thursday. If you're new (welcome!), the short version: bursty callers get a 429 now instead of quietly degrading everyone else. Limits are generous, so most services won't notice. Test against staging first. The staging build carries the token shown just below.

pipeline stamp: htk4_ae36

Canary gating for Driftwell: promotion to 50% traffic requires error rate under 0.4% and p95 latency under 300ms for 15 minutes. Support should not override gates without approval from the on-call lead. Before re-running the gate checker, update the canary env file; the signing secret line goes directly below this sentence.

sealed setting: LEDGER_TOKEN5=bcca1

Ticket #— Floor 9 Opening Prep, Brindlemoor House

Hi facilities folks, Floor 9 opens to staff next Monday and we need a few things squared away before then. Lift access is live, but the two side doors by the kitchenette are still on the old lock config — please reprogram them before Friday. Also, signage for the quiet rooms hasn't arrived, so pop up the temporary printed ones for now. Until the badge readers sync, the interim door code for Floor 9 is below.

door code, bajop-bajog: bdg-DSWAC-43621

Finance Review — Marketing Budget

Decision: Q2 marketing spend for the Orvane line cut 18%, effective next cycle. Paid campaigns paused; events budget halved; retention spend protected. Rationale: margin pressure and soft pipeline in the Calder region. Department heads to resubmit plans within ten days. A confidential note on related plans follows below.

management briefing: Project Ulavan slips by two quarters because of the staffing delay.